With large charts, diagrams, and many playing examples, nothing is left to the imagination. About the Actor David Barrett is the world's most published author of the blues harmonica. Having played saxophone and trumpet for many years David already had a solid musical platform when he started to play the harmonica at age fourteen. By age sixteen he was already playing blues jam sessions and harmonica shows in the California bay area. By age eighteen he was studying music theory in college and started teaching harmonica at local music institutes. By age twenty he released his first book, Building Harmonica Technique, with Mel Bay Publications. While finishing his degree in music he had the opportunity to take over a local music store that helped spur the beginning of the Harmonica Masterclass Workshop. David now runs the Harmonica Masterclass Company full time, bringing lesson books, lesson videos, private instruction, and workshops to players all around the world. David has worked and played with Charlie Musselwhite, Mark Hummel, Lee Oskar, Rod Piazza, James Harman, Gary Smith, Andy Just, Mark Ford, Billy Boy Arnold, Rick Estrin, Paul deLay, Jerry Portnoy, Gary Primich, Howard Levy, Magic Dick, Tom Ball, Annie Raines, Paul Oscher, Phil Wiggins, and Brendan Power. He now fronts his own band featuring John Garcia on guitar and vocals. David is the owner of the Harmonica Masterclass Company, that specializes in harmonica products and workshops for blues harmonica. His last workshop had twenty-six states and eight countries represented in attendance. Through his numerous instructional books and videos, David is revolutionizing the way the harmonica is taught.

Great DVD for Beginning Blues Harpers
I can understand why another reviewer would be miffed that another book with another CD needs to be bought to complete this DVD seris; granted, it should have been lumped together as a package but then again, how many people want to shell out $50 for their first blues harp lesson? Not too many! As unfortunate as that marketing snafu is/was, it should not detract from the quality dvd that this presents for the beginning blues harp player. I've suffered through at least three (3) CD Beginner Lessons by three different authors (including some notable names) and they couldn't teach me in two weeks of listening that this dvd didn't teach me in one hour of playing! Nothing compares to having someone SHOW you how it's done - it's almost like having your own private instructor next to you demonstrating what to do and what not to do. I started out by pursing my lips - yup, that's what LISTENING to CD instructions does - you can't really tell what they're trying to teach. But within minutes of watching this dvd, I learned how to play the harp the right way. The rest will be up to me and practice. This DVD also got me buying the several other Mel Bay DVDs that go into more detail. I also went and bought that pesky book and cd set that should have been bundled with this dvd in the first place (okay, deduct style points for that one). The bottom line is that I would recommend this DVD over any other audio CD to anyone seriously contemplating getting started by playing it the right way and not having to unlearn a bunch of things you imagine should be done with any audio instructions. Buy this product and similar Mel Bay DVDs - skip the CDs if you want to save a few bucks until you're sure you are serious about practicing.

GOOD INSTRUCTION BUT POOR QUALITY VIDEO TO DVD TRANSFER
The Basic Blues Harp instructional material on this dvd is very good and David Barrett is an excellent teacher but the image quality of the dvd is not at all as good as the other dvds of David's more advanced Harmonica Instruction: Mel Bay Building Harmonica Technique DVD Vol. 1 & 2 and Mel Bay Building Harmonica Technique DVD Vol. 3 & 4. I think this dvd lost a lot of image quality when it was transferred for the original source tape.You'll be pleasantly surprised when you've learned this material and move on to the Building Harmonica Technique DVDs 1 & 2 and 3 & 4. The screen image quality on those two dvds is sharp and clear - as image quality should be with the dvd format.

Beginn einer großen Unterrichtsreihe
Diese DVD steht am Anfang einer in 3 Serien gestaffelten Unterrichtsreihe aus insgesamt 17 Produkten ( meist Hefte und CDs).Die Reihe behandelt das Bluesharmonikaspiel auf der Richter-Mundharmonika in C.Diese DVD befasst sich mit der Auswahl des Instruments,des Mikrophons, des Verstärkers, der Haltung, Atmung, dem Blasansatz, den Tönen der Kanäle, der Artikulation, den Spieltechniken Vibrato, Tongue Blocking, Tongue Slap, der Durtonleiter, den Akkorden, und dem 12 Takt-Schema des Blues.Der Vorteil der DVD ist, dass ähnlich wie bei einem richtigen Lehrer Ansatz, Atmung und Haltung vorgeführt werden können.Das Spiel selbst wird erst durch die anderen Folgen der Serie erlernt.Zum Verständnis der DVD sollte man gute Kenntnisse des amerikanischen Englisch besitzen.Die DVD wurde 2000 produziert in NTSC for all regions. Laufzeit 70 Minuten.Die Bildqualität ist nicht sehr hoch. Sie auf Bildschirmgröße abzuspielen, ist kein Highlight.Der Gesamtpreis des Pakets lässt sich erst durch Addition der Einzelpreise ermitteln, sofern sie noch alle im Handel sind.

Fairly good, jumps into music theory and notation a little ...
Fairly good, jumps into music theory and notation a little too quickly, probably fine if you already play music and are familiar with notation, but not the best choice for a complete beginner. The DVD looks very dated.
